What companies run services between Liverpool, England and Hugh Baird College, England?

Merseyrail operates a train from Moorfields to Bootle Oriel Road every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£1–4 and the journey takes 7 min. Alternatively, Arriva UK operates a bus from Great Richmond Street to Balliol Road every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 11 min. Stagecoach Merseyside & South Lancashire also services this route every 15 minutes.
